After starting their season with two straight games on the road, Weslaco is finally coming home. They will be defending their home-fieldthey go up against the Laredo LBJ Wolves at 7:00 p.m. on Friday. Given that the two teams suffered a loss in their last game, they both have a little extra motivation heading into this match.
Last Friday, Weslaco came up short against McAllen Memorial and fell 45-38.
Despite their loss, Weslaco saw several players rise to the challenge and make noteworthy plays. Francisco Trevino, who rushed for 94 yards and three touchdowns on only 13 carries, and also threw for 211 yards and a touchdown on only 16 passes, was perhaps the best of all. The dominant performance gave him a new career- in total yards. Another rusher making a difference was David Garcia, who rushed for 121 yards and a touchdown on only 15 carries.
Meanwhile, while it was all tied up 7-7 at halftime, Laredo LBJ was not quite Nixon's equal in the second half on Thursday. They took a 21-13 hit to the loss column at the hands of the Mustangs.
Weslaco's defeat dropped their record down to 0-2. As for Laredo LBJ, their loss dropped their record down to 1-1.
